Mathematics for Engineering and Experimental Sciences using Mathematica by Cesar Lopez Perez
English | Jan. 15, 2016 | ISBN: 1523417404 | 250 Pages | AZW3/MOBI/EPUB/PDF (conv) | 11.8 MB

You can use Mathematica as a powerful numerical computer. While most calculators handle numbers only to a preset degree of precision, Mathematica performs exact calculations to any desired degree of precision.

In addition, unlike calculators, we can perform operations not only with individual numbers, but also with objects such as arrays. Most of the topics of classical numerical analysis are treated by this software. It supports matrix calculus, statistics, interpolation, least squares fitting, numerical integration, minimization of functions, linear programming, numerical and algebraic solutions of differential equations and a long list of further methods that we'll meet as this book progresses. The book begins with a practical introduction in Mathematica. Through successive chapters it delves into topics such as continuity, differentiability and integration of functions of one and several variables. It also works in the field of differential equations, partial differential differential equations, systems of differential equations and difference equations. The concepts are illustrated with many examples and end of each chapter a number of exercises are solved to understand the theoretical concepts
